Excerpt from Reports of Cases, Decided in the Superior Court of Chancery, of the State of Mississippi, Vol. 1: Containing a Series of Cases Between December Term 1839, and July Term, 1843 The territorial jurisdiction of this court extends over twenty two counties in the northern section of the state. The vice chancellor has concurrent jurisdiction with the chancellor, in said district, in all cases where the amount in controversy does not exceed five hundred thousand dollars. An appeal lies from the District to the Superior Court of Chancery, unless, by consent of both parties, the case is taken directly to the High Court of Enors and Appeals.
